9. Brincliffe Crescent, Brincliffe - £2,000,000
This period property, known as Muswell Lodge, is just a short stroll away from the many shops, bars and restaurants in Sharrowvale and Nether Edge. Built in the Victorians, this six-bedroom home is laid out over three floors and boasts extensive south-facing grounds, as well as a kitchen garden. In the basement is a wine cellar and a large room with the potential to develop into additional accommodation. Photo: Rightmove

10. Croft Lane, Whirlow - £2,200,000
This six-bedroom property is one of the most expensive homes in Sheffield. The house was built in 1901 and it has been upgraded to a very high standard, while still retaining some of its fine original features. It is set in professionally landscaped grounds of approximately 0.65 of an acre, providing plenty of space to have the whole family together in the summer sunshine. Photo: Rightmove
